Temperature Variations and Paint Performance



Temperature level variants play an essential role in paint efficiency, influencing whatever from adhesion to longevity. When you apply paint in extreme temperatures, whether warm or cold, it can result in bad results. If it's also cool, the paint might not cure appropriately, causing a weak bond to the surface area. You could observe peeling or flaking right after application if you ignore this factor.

On the other hand, applying paint in heats can trigger the paint to completely dry too rapidly, which can cause problems like brush marks or an uneven surface. You want your paint to stream smoothly and adhere well, so timing your application according to temperature level is critical.

Additionally, temperature level variations can create the paint film to expand and agreement, bring about fractures and other damages gradually. Particularly in areas with significant temperature level swings, you'll wish to select a paint specifically created to withstand these modifications.

Before beginning your job, examine the weather forecast and ensure you're working within the temperature level range advised by the paint producer. By doing this, you'll boost the longevity of your paint job and preserve its aesthetic appeal for longer.

Humidity's Impact on Finishing Longevity



Moisture substantially impacts paint longevity, frequently in ways that can stun property owners and experts alike. High moisture levels can impede the drying process of paint, bring about longer drying times and possibly trapping wetness beneath the surface area.



This trapped moisture can trigger the paint to raise, bubble, or peel off, dramatically decreasing its durability. Alternatively, incredibly reduced moisture can result in quick evaporation, which could trigger the paint to dry too quickly.

This can lead to poor attachment and a harsh coating, making the coating much more susceptible to damages. It's essential to select the right time for painting, preferably throughout moderate humidity levels, to make certain optimal outcomes.

You must also take into consideration the type of paint you're using. Some solutions are especially developed to withstand high humidity, using far better adhesion and versatility.

Applying a primer can additionally aid by developing an obstacle versus wetness, enhancing longevity.

UV Direct Exposure and Color Fade



Ultraviolet (UV) direct exposure constantly plays an important role in paint toughness, specifically when it comes to shade retention.

When you choose exterior paint for your business building, you require to be aware that UV rays from the sunlight can break down the chemical bonds in the paint. This failure results in color fade, reducing the lively look you at first wanted.

If your building deals with straight sunlight for extensive periods, you'll observe this fading extra swiftly. The strength and angle of sunlight can likewise impact how quickly your paint sheds its luster.

Lighter shades tend to reveal fading greater than darker shades, but all shades are susceptible to UV deterioration.

To combat this issue, consider making use of paint formulated with UV-resistant buildings. These specialized paints consist of ingredients that assist protect the surface from damaging rays, prolonging the color's life-span.

Routine upkeep, like cleaning the surface areas and applying touch-ups, can likewise aid protect the paint's look.
